Understanding Lead Collection

    Lead collection refers to the process of capturing potential customer information—such as names, email addresses, phone numbers, and other relevant details—that allow a business to follow up with these prospects. The primary goal is to identify individuals who are interested in what your business has to offer and to nurture these leads through various stages of the sales funnel until they convert into paying customers.
    Lead collection serves multiple purposes:
  1. Market Intelligence: Gather useful data on potential customers to understand their needs, preferences, and behavior.
  2. Sales Pipeline Fuel: Keep your sales funnel full to ensure a steady flow of potential buyers.

Traditional Methods of Lead Collection

    There are several tried-and-true methods online businesses use to collect leads:
    1. Web Forms These are embedded on your website to capture visitor information. Typically found on landing pages, contact pages, and pop-ups, web forms are a straightforward way to request key details from prospective clients.
    1. Email Subscriptions Through newsletters and email marketing campaigns, businesses can encourage website visitors to subscribe by offering free resources like e-books, whitepapers, or exclusive discounts.
    1. Content Downloads Providing downloadable content like checklists, reports, and guides in exchange for contact information effectively turns content into a lead generation tool.
    1. Social Media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n offer feature ad spaces specifically designed to capture leads through sign-up forms that prompt users to enter their details within the platform.
    1. Webinars and Events Hosting virtual events like webinars provides a great opportunity for businesses to capture leads. Registration typically requires filling out a form, gathering crucial lead information before the potential customer even attends the webinar.

The AI Chatbot Revolution in Lead Collection

    With technological advancements, lead collection has taken a significant leap forward. AI chatbots have emerged as game-changers, offering efficient and engaging means to capture leads. Here’s how AI chatbots help enhance lead collection:
    1. Instant Engagement: AI chatbots can engage visitors the moment they land on your website, offering assistance and capturing interest instantly. This proactive engagement captures leads who might otherwise leave without interacting.
    1. 24/7 Availability: Unlike human operators, chatbots are available around the clock. This ensures that you capture leads at any time, irrespective of time zones or business hours.
    1. Personalized Conversation: Chatbots can utilize machine learning to understand user behavior and preferences. They can personalize conversations, making the interaction more engaging and relevant to the visitor’s needs.
    1. Streamlined Data Collection: Chatbots can request necessary information incrementally during the conversation. This conversational style of data gathering is far less intrusive than lengthy web forms, and often leads to higher completion rates.
    1. Qualifying Leads: AI chatbots can ask qualifying questions to segment leads and score them. This helps in prioritizing high-quality leads to direct your sales team’s efforts where they are most likely to convert.
    1. Timely Follow-Up: Chatbots can be programmed to follow up with potential leads by offering additional information, scheduling demo meetings, or sending reminders. This ensures a continual nurturing process that keeps potential leads engaged.
